Kingsley Moghalu, a former Deputy Governor of the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N), and his wife, Maryanne have recounted how they escaped a faulty elevator accident.

VerseNews reports that in a video shared on the microblogging platform, X, formerly known as Twitter, Moghalu’s wife recounted that the elevator stopped in between floors.

“This morning, @MoghaluKingsley and I were stuck in an elevator for over 30 minutes! The elevator stopped in between floors. I thank God it ended well,” Mrs Moghalu shared.

“This is why you don’t leave home without praying. Ps 91. Never know what is waiting around the corner. Glory to God!”

Advertisement

Although, she did not state the location where they incident occurred but admitted it is wise for one to pray before leaving the house.

This comes barely two weeks after a doctor in Lagos State lost her life in an elevator.
